Best Tonawanda Public High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public high schools serving 1,943 students in Tonawanda, NY.
The top-ranked public high schools in Tonawanda, NY are Kenmore East Senior High School and Tonawanda Middle/high School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Tonawanda, NY public high schools have an average math proficiency score of 55% (versus the New York public high school average of 55%), and reading proficiency score of 44% (versus the 59% statewide average). High schools in Tonawanda have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of New York public high schools.
Tonawanda, NY public high school have a Graduation Rate of 88%, which is less than the New York average of 89%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Kenmore East Senior High School, with 89%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in New York or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 26%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the New York public high school average of 62% (majority Hispanic).
